diff options
author | Roman Smrž <roman.smrz@seznam.cz> | 2024-12-03 20:47:06 +0100 |
---|---|---|
committer | Roman Smrž <roman.smrz@seznam.cz> | 2024-12-03 21:33:19 +0100 |
commit | 1b26af0b8da3bf9527d92978b3f23c851c749510 (patch) | |
tree | 0fda22a42d6ac023105f4ec85f4cd078d141bb3f /src/Run/Monad.hs | |
parent | 217f647ade516ad8eacd25ea74701fd29d98f7e3 (diff) |
Ignore missing variables when gathering used values
Diffstat (limited to 'src/Run/Monad.hs')
-rw-r--r-- | src/Run/Monad.hs |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/src/Run/Monad.hs b/src/Run/Monad.hs index f605dfb..3739e2e 100644 --- a/src/Run/Monad.hs +++ b/src/Run/Monad.hs @@ -92,7 +92,7 @@ instance MonadError Failed TestRun where instance MonadEval TestRun where askDictionary = asks (tsVars . snd) - withVar name value = local (fmap $ \s -> s { tsVars = ( name, someConstValue value ) : tsVars s }) + withDictionary f = local (fmap $ \s -> s { tsVars = f (tsVars s) }) instance MonadOutput TestRun where getOutput = asks $ teOutput . fst |